Stephen Black is an ATCK who grew up in Nigeria. He started this podcast to help TCKs, their families, and their care communities talk about what it means to be a TCK and how to care for the TCKs in their lives.

Taking Route Podcast focuses on conversations about living abroad, expat to expat. They unpack what it means to fully take root while en route.

Two teenagers share what it is like living overseas as teenagers, living cross culturally, and loving Jesus on Both Sides of the Bunk Bed!

 

 Rachel Cason is an ATCK who now works as a licensed therapist in the UK. She specializes in helping TCKs center themselves in their own stories and identities. In this podcast, she shares about personal growth, working with pain, and the transformative change that comes from a better understanding of our own stories. 

Michèle Phoenix is an ATCK who grew up in France. She is also an international speaker and writer on issues related to Third Culture Kids. In this podcast, she highlights her most popular and helpful articles in a format you can consume on the go.
